Ni hao? What is the word for “to avoid” the dictionary said bi4 tone but there are too many words, “atheist”, “god”, and “to be complicated”?
I try to avoid him.
I try to avoid getting hit.
My relation is complicated.
The problem is too complicated to explain.
He is an atheist, he doesn’t think there is a god.

| | Benny the Mandarin Teacher askbenny.net 2010-05-04 / 07:41PM | | Hi there,
Avoid in Chinese is “避免” or "避开”(mainly used for person)
I try to avoid him. = wǒ shì zhé bì kāi ta
I try to avoid getting hit. = wǒ shì zhé bì miǎn bèi zhuàng
Complicate = fù zá
My relation is complicated. = wǒ de guān xi hěn fù zá
The problem is too complicated to explain. = zhè ge wèn tí tài nán jiě shì.
atheist = wú shén lùn zhě
He is an atheist, he doesn’t think there is a god. = tā shì wú shén lùn zhě, tā bù xiāng xìn yǒu shàng dì
